Types of Welder’s Certifications

While the AWS’ regular CW credential helps make you eligible for almost all job opportunities, some industries call for a specialized certificate. Some of the most-well-known of these are listed below.

  • CWI and SCWI Certification for Welding Inspectors and Senior Welding Inspectors
  • API Certification for individuals that work on pipelines in the energy field
  • Certified Welder Certificates to be a Certified Welder
  • American Society of Mechanical Engineers Certification for individuals who deal with boiler and pressurized vessels

The subsequent graphic features employment and wages projections for welding professionals in the State of Florida through 2022.

Florida Employment
2012 2022 Change Annual Job Openings
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ers 11,720 14,620 25% 600
Florida Annual Salary
Low Median High
Welders,
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ers
$23,600 $35,100 $53,800

Source: O*Net Online

A Look Inside Welding Specialist Courses

As soon as it is time to select which welding schools you want to enroll in, there are a few issues that you will want to look into. The first task in getting started in a job as a welding specialist is to decide which of the outstanding welding specialist classes will be right for you. For starters, find out if the is endorsed or certified by the American Welding Society. While not as crucial as the program’s accreditation status, you might like to look into several of the following areas too:

  • Be sure the college’s curriculum provides you with classes in SMAW, GMAW, GTAW and pipe welding
  • Choose courses that comply with AWS SENSE standards
  • See if the school offers financial assistance
  • Make sure the institution teaches with technology that fits the latest field requirements
